In the context of the Internet of Things (IoT) and abstraction, the correct answer would be:
A smart drier has sensors that stop the drier when no moisture is detected in the clothes.
This option illustrates abstraction in IoT technology because it involves simplifying the user's interaction by using sensors to automatically control the drier's operation without the user needing to monitor the moisture levels manually. The technology abstracts away the complexity of moisture detection and drying process management.
